When I start the engine I have fuel leaking from where the fuel line enters the 'carby (around the needle and seat area). I have tightened the fuel line connection, checked the needle and seat condition, however it still leaks fuel everywhere.

Any help to fix this problem is welcomed.

Inspect the end of your fuel line carefully; the flare may have cracked. Also check for stripped threads where the brass inlet fitting screws into the carb, and check that the proper gasket is used.
